Pathways to La Trobe University

La Trobe University offers Foundation Programs and Diploma Programs on their campus in Melbourne. These programs provide an academic bridge for International students into degree studies at La Trobe University.

Students may undertake a Foundation Studies Program that will upgrade their present qualifications to the level required to enter to Bachelor Degrees at La Trobe University across all discipline areas.  For more information about entrance requirements from Foundation Studies into Bachelor degree please see:  http://www.latrobe.edu.au/international/apply/apply_req.html 

Alternatively, students may undertake a La Trobe Diploma. We offer Diplomas in Business Administration and Information Systems. La Trobe Diplomas qualify students to enter second year of the relevant degree. For more information about La Trobe Diplomas, please see: http://www.latrobe.edu.au/fsp/dipl.html

There are three intakes per year for international students to study Foundation and Diploma programs. This provides students with numerous benefits including considerable savings of time and money.

La Trobe University English Language Centre

La Trobe University was the first university in Melbourne to establish an English language centre for overseas students. Since 1974, thousands of students from all over the world, and from many backgrounds have chosen to study our English language courses.

The Centre is located on one of the largest university campuses in Australia, situated in beautiful landscaped grounds in Bundoora, Melbourne, with over 17,000 students and an extensive range of services and facilities.

The English Intensive Courses for Overseas Students (ELICOS) provides for different objectives and levels of English. The courses on offer are: 

·         General English

·         English for Further Studies

·         English for Business

·         English and Internship  (Certificate II in Professional Communication)

·         Cambridge First Certificate in English (FCE) Preparation

·         Insight into Australia Program
